Burrillville's construction market in 2026 reflects a combination of local labor rates, material availability, and permitting environment. With a cost index of 0.98x relative to the Rhode Island state average, Burrillville sits below most Northeast markets.
Labor Costs
Skilled trades in Burrillville average competitive rates vs state average. Plan for subcontractor scheduling 6-10 weeks out.
Permits & Fees
Burrillville building permits typically cost $1,500-$4,500 depending on scope. Budget this before breaking ground.
Material Costs
Competitive material pricing in Burrillville. Budget a 10% contingency for lumber fluctuations.
Land & Site Work
Burrillville lot prices vary widely by neighborhood. Site prep and utility hookups typically add $15,000-$45,000 on top of construction costs.
Timeline
A typical new home in Burrillville takes 9-14 months from permit to move-in. Permitting alone can take 6-12 weeks.

Is it cheaper to build or buy a house in Burrillville?
Buying an existing home in Burrillville is often cheaper upfront than building new. However, new construction offers full customization, modern energy efficiency, and no hidden repair costs. Building makes the most sense when inventory is limited or you already own a lot.
How long does it take to build a house in Burrillville?
New home construction in Burrillville typically takes 9-14 months from breaking ground to move-in. Permitting takes 6-12 weeks, foundation and framing 2-3 months, mechanical rough-ins 1-2 months, and finishes 2-3 months.
What is the cheapest way to build a house in Burrillville?
To minimize costs in Burrillville: choose a simple rectangular floor plan, select builder-grade finishes, use a slab foundation where the lot allows, and get at least 3 bids from local general contractors. A basic 1,200 sq ft home can be built for as little as $169,248.
Do I need a permit to build in Burrillville, Rhode Island?
Yes. All new residential construction in Burrillville requires a building permit from the local municipality. Budget $1,500-$4,500 for permit fees and plan for a 6-12 week review period before breaking ground.
